import QtQuick
import "../.."

// The state line under the tile label. One line per active link: the API
// exposes no route metric, so when both wired and wifi are up the tile shows
// both rather than guessing which one carries traffic.
Column {
    required property var net

    width: parent ? parent.width : implicitWidth
    spacing: 2

    Text {
        width: parent.width
        elide: Text.ElideRight
        visible: net.wiredUp
        text: net.wiredName
        font { family: Theme.fontFamily; pixelSize: Theme.fontSize - 4 }
        color: Theme.text
    }

    Text {
        width: parent.width
        elide: Text.ElideRight
        visible: net.wifiUp
        text: net.wifiSsid
        font { family: Theme.fontFamily; pixelSize: Theme.fontSize - 4 }
        color: Theme.text
    }

    Text {
        width: parent.width
        elide: Text.ElideRight
        visible: !net.wiredUp && !net.wifiUp
        text: net.wifiOn ? "Disconnected" : "Off"
        font { family: Theme.fontFamily; pixelSize: Theme.fontSize - 4 }
        color: Theme.subtext
    }
}
